NewMedia SPARK PLC 13 September 2001 13 September 2001 NewMedia SPARK plc Announces Extension of Subsequent Offering Period NewMedia SPARK plc (LSE: NMS) ('SPARK') today announced the further extension of the subsequent offering period in connection with the cash tender offer to purchase all of the outstanding shares of GlobalNet Financial.com, Inc. (Nasdaq: GLBN; LSE: GLFA) ('GlobalNet'). Due to the tragic events in the United States which occurred on Tuesday 11 September 2001, SPARK has extended the subsequent offering period to enable shareholders who were unable to tender during Tuesday and Wednesday to have an opportunity to tender their shares . The subsequent offering period will now expire at 5:00 p.m. on Friday September 21, 2001, unless further extended. As a result of the recent events in New York city, the Bank of New York which is acting as depository for the Offer, is in the process of relocating its 101 Barclay Street office and SPARK will announce as soon as available a new location where The Bank of New York will be accepting completed Letters of Transmittal to accept the Offer. The subsequent offering period to the tender offer was previously scheduled to expire at 5:00 p.m., New York City time, on Wednesday, September 12, 2001. During the extended subsequent offering period, common stock and class A common stock of GlobalNet will be purchased at a price of $0.45 per share of common stock and $0.045 per share of class A common stock, net to the seller in cash, without interest thereon. If shares representing at least of 80.1% of the combined voting power of GlobalNet are tendered before the expiration of the subsequent offering period, GlobalNet Acquisitions (a wholly owned subsidiary of SPARK) intends to exercise its option to purchase an additional amount of shares of GlobalNet common stock so that following such exercise GlobalNet Acquisitions will own shares representing at least 90% of the combined voting power of GlobalNet. In such case, SPARK intends to complete the merger of GlobalNet Acquisitions with and into GlobalNet under Section 253 of the Delaware General Corporation Law.
